Iran has warned Donald Trump it has “one million fighters” ready to respond if US troops are sent into the country, adding they will unleash “hell”. State-run Tasnim News Agency, citing a military source, said Iran’s “ground fighters” are becoming more enthusiastic about creating “a historic hell for the Americans on Iranian soil”.
The source said young Iranians are applying to join the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C), the army, and the Basij, a paramilitary volunteer militia. They also warned the US against pushing further to gain control of the Strait of Hormuz, which could result in “suicide and self-destruction”.
The source said: “America wants to open the Strait through suicide and self-destruction; that’s fine. We are prepared for them to act on their suicide strategy, and for the Strait to remain closed.”
Tasnim reported: “As speculation grows about the possibility of America’s historic folly of entering a ground battle on Iran’s southern front, a wave of enthusiasm has formed among Iran’s ground fighters to create a historic hell for the Americans on Iranian soil.
“He noted that in addition to organising over one million fighters for ground combat, a massive influx of applications from young Iranians has poured into the centres of the Basij, the Revolutionary Guard Corps, and the Army in recent days to participate in this fight as well.”
However, special envoy Steve Witkoff said during a Cabinet meeting on Thursday that “it became quite clear” that Iran wouldn’t agree to a deal that fulfilled Washington’s objectives.
He also claimed that Iranian negotiators told the US that they have enough uranium to make “11 atomic bombs”. He added: “Finally, we have told Iran one last thing: don#t miscalculate again.”
